Apart from the obvious question, I'm not sure what putting velcro on the top
is going to do to prevent the window pocket from blowing around. I suppose
you could rig something up, but it wouldn't be a simple piece of velcro
unless I'm missing something (which I obviously am). If you want to velcro
the window border to the pocket, you can get velcro that doesn't have
adhesive on the back, it's designed to be sewn into things, and can probably
be found in sewing supply stores. One piece can be glued to the window
border, and the other stitched into the pocket, but that seems like an awful
lot of work considering that the window pocket stays down very nicely under
the weight of the top.
